Alright, so you wanna know about them Labrador Retriever mixed with German Shepherd dogs, huh? Well, let me tell ya, it’s like this. You got your Labrador, real friendly, loves to fetch, always waggin’ their tail. Then you got your German Shepherd, smart as a whip, protective, kinda serious-looking.

Finding a Healthy Labrador Retriever Mixed with German Shepherd Puppy

Now, when you mix ‘em up, you get somethin’ else entirely. They call ‘em German Shepradors sometimes, or Labrashepherds. Sounds fancy, but it just means a dog that’s got a bit of both in ‘em. It ain’t rocket science, you know?

Think of it like makin’ a stew. You got your potatoes and your carrots, each one’s good on its own. But when you put ‘em together, you get somethin’ new and tasty. Same with these dogs. You mix that friendly Labrador with that smart German Shepherd, and you get a dog that’s likely gonna be friendly *and* smart. Makes sense, right?

These dogs, they’re usually pretty big, like, medium to large. Think fifty to ninety pounds, maybe more. They got a lotta energy, gotta run ‘em around, otherwise they’ll be tearin’ up your house, I tell ya. They need to move. You can’t just keep ‘em cooped up all day. That ain’t right.

  • Size: Medium to large, fifty to ninety pounds or so.
  • Energy: Lots of it! Gotta keep ‘em busy.
  • Personality: Friendly, smart, loyal, probably good watchdogs too.

Is it safe to mix ‘em? Sure, why not? People been mixin’ dogs forever. It ain’t like it’s gonna blow up or somethin’. Long as the parents are healthy, the puppies should be fine. You gotta make sure the people you’re gettin’ the dog from, they know what they’re doin’, though. Don’t wanna get ripped off with a sick puppy.

If you’re lookin’ for one of these German Shepherd Lab mix pups, you gotta do your homework. Find a good breeder, someone who cares about the dogs, not just the money. Ask a lot of questions. See the parents, if you can. And make sure you’re ready for a dog that needs a lotta attention and exercise. These ain’t no couch potatoes, let me tell ya.
